## Offline mode environments — Terracount field app

Offline mode on Terracount caches survey batches locally and replays them once connectivity returns. Staging and production use separate replay queues; never point a device at both. If replay stalls past thirty minutes, page the sync team. The staging replay service currently runs with these configuration values.

settings of tagef-bawif:
DRUIX_HOST=druix.zemvarlabs.internal
DRUIX_PORT=8000

Fixes rounding drift in the Spoonwright recipe-scaling calculator when scaling below 0.5x. Fractional gram amounts now round half-even, and yeast/salt get a floor so tiny batches stay viable. On-call: if users report odd quantities, check the scale factor bounds before rolling back. All thresholds moved into a single constants block for quick patching. Current values shipped with this change are shown below.

constants for kageg-bawif:
QUOTAS = {
    "quenwyn": 1,
    "oliix": 10,
}

Plugins for Gatewick, the stadium turnstile counter, must ship signed artifacts. Unsigned bundles are rejected at install. Build your plugin, generate the manifest, then sign the archive before publishing to the Fennick registry. Counter cores in the Arlowe Dome verify signatures on every load, no exceptions. All third-party submissions are verified against the project signing key below.

deploy key for kajof-fajop: bky6_gDHw9Q